Richmond-Dispatch, Richmond, VA

September 28, 1854

The Abingdon Democrat, of Sept. 23d, says:

The dysentery has been distressingly fatal in the neighborhood of Hansonville, Russell county, within the last few weeks, and particularly among children. Twenty-two children had died up to Tuesday evening last, within a circle of two miles of Hansonville - the eldest not more than nine years of age. In addition to these there has been considerable mortality among older persons. The neighboring town of Marion and other portions of Smyth county, has likewise suffered dreadfully.
